The boss is very nice and respectful of employees, but is too busy to train the new employees except for very little. He is always there for us when we call though. If you are new, you have to ask questions and learn the HUGE wealth of knowledge that you have to learn about all the security systems ON YOUR OWN completely! That is the worst part. Then on top of that you do not make enough to even pay your bills because of all the gas spent going to the appointments all over "tim-buck-too" to someones house that might be a creep all by yourself. Also, the little money we were making on sales just got cut virtually in half. :( The last and final thing is that when you go to an appointment you could drive as far as 2 1/2 hours away and then the customer does not want a security system, so then you wasted you time, all of your gas, and you got ZERO dollars out of the whole thing. All of this is ONLY COMMISSION! There is hardly no way for anyone to live on commission alone.....even if they are making the 50 calls a day to try and get an appointment set to sell a security system. There are great people that I work with including my boss who is nice and understanding and help the best he can....but they give him too much work for him to be able to help very much. But unfortunately just working with nice people won't pay my bills. :(

Good company to work for, huge customer base and big brand that sells itself. They pay well when you get deals signed. You get a lot of freedom when you perform well

Cons

Pay is full commission. It’s a lot of self hunting and prospecting, Not a big deal but that’s a deal breaker for some. A lot of the job you learn as you go, you’ll start to get familiar with the equipment and the sales process. When you don’t perform you will be micromanaged. Company does not like to “fire” so they will ride you to help you get on. Track if you’re not making quota.
